Abstract

Stroke is a leading cause of global mortality that requires early detection through artificial intelligence technologies. This study aims to conduct a comparative analysis between Logistic Regression and Random Forest models in predicting stroke risk based on health and lifestyle data. The study utilized the Stroke Prediction Dataset, which underwent preprocessing, standardization, and class imbalance handling. Model performance was evaluated using Accuracy, Precision, Recall, and ROC-AUC metrics. The results demonstrate that Random Forest significantly outperformed Logistic Regression with an AUC value of 0.990 compared to 0.892. Random Forest proved to be more effective for medical screening, achieving a Recall of 96.29%, which is substantially higher than Logistic Regression at 83.71%. Furthermore, Random Forest demonstrated superior capability in capturing non-linear data patterns in complex variables such as BMI. It is concluded that Random Forest is the recommended method for stroke early detection systems due to its ability to minimize undetected positive cases (false negatives).
